Abstract

The utility model discloses a kind of lithium battery groups to weld bracket, including bottom plate and the first link block, the top end surface center of the bottom plate is connected with the first link block, the top of first link block is connected with the second connecting column, the top outer wall of second connecting column is connected with first bearing, and the outer wall of the first bearing is connected with the first connecting column.A kind of lithium battery group weldering bracket, pass through the first connecting column, first bearing, the cooperation of inserted link and the second connecting column, having reached can be such that the first connecting column and the second connecting column is rotated, pass through top plate, stud, nut, sliding slot, first connecting rod, fixed plate, second connecting column, fixture block, first groove, the cooperation of second link block and clamping plate, rotating bolt is reached clamping plate can be made to carry out Quick-clamped to lithium battery and has fixed and Rapid reversal is fixedly clamped, rotating welding is carried out with to the lithium battery after clamping, it is easy to operate, it is easy to use, quickly lithium battery can be welded.

Background technique
Lithium battery is one kind using lithium metal or lithium alloy as negative electrode material, using the one-shot battery of non-aqueous electrolytic solution, It with lithium ion polymer battery is different with rechargeable battery lithium ion battery, such as application No. is: 201720777966.5 patent, including bracket, the bracket are equipped with circular groove, and the bottom of the bracket is equipped with bottom plate, Bottom plate is equipped with conductive film track, and the edge of the bracket is equipped with clamping apparatus, the patent although accomplished can by lithium battery into Row is fixedly welded, but can not accomplish lithium battery rotating welding is fixed, and increases trouble for user, impracticable.

Fig. 1-4 is please referred to, the utility model provides a kind of technical solution: a kind of lithium battery group weldering bracket, including 1 He of bottom plate First link block 2, the bottom end of the bottom plate are connected with the second rubber pad 22, and the second rubber pad 22 plays the work for increasing frictional force With the top end surface center of bottom plate 1 is connected with the first link block 2, and the top of the first link block 2 is connected with the second connecting column 17, the first link block 2 is fixed by the second connecting column 17, and the top outer wall of the second connecting column 17 is connected with first bearing 5, and second connects It connects column 17 and the inner ring of first bearing 5 is fixedly linked, the outer wall of first bearing 5 is connected with the first connecting column 4, the first connecting column 4 Can be equipped with inserted link 6 in the outer ring rotating of first bearing 5, the inner cavity of the first connecting column 4, inserted link 6 through the first connecting column 4 with Second connecting column, 17 grafting is connected, can be by the first connection when inserted link 6 is inserted into the first connecting column 4 and the second connecting column 17 Column 4 and the second connecting column 17 are fixed, prevent the second connecting rod 4 from continuing to rotate with the second connecting column 17, the top of the first connecting column 4 It is connected with top plate 7, the left and right sides inner cavity of top plate 7 is provided with the second groove 25, and the inside outer wall of the second groove 25 is connected with Two bearings 24, the inner ring of second bearing 24 are connected with stud 8, and the outer wall thread of stud 8 is connected with nut 9, and stud 8 can when rotating So that nut 9 is moved left and right in the outer wall of stud 8, the top of top plate 7 is provided with sliding slot 10, and the top of nut 9 is connected with the first company Extension bar 11, first connecting rod 11 and 10 clearance fit of sliding slot, when nut 9 moves left and right, first connecting rod 11 is simultaneously in sliding slot 10 Inner cavity in move left and right, the top of first connecting rod 11 is connected with fixed plate 12, and first connecting rod 11 is moved in sliding slot 10 or so When dynamic, it is fixed in 11 fixed plate 12 of first connecting rod while moves left and right, the top of fixed plate 12 is connected with the second connecting rod 13, The second connecting rod 13 is moved left and right when first connecting rod 11 is mobile, the inside of the second connecting column 13 is provided with the first groove 20, Rotation is connected with fixture block 14 in the inner cavity of first groove 20, and the inside of fixture block 14 is connected with the second link block 21, the second link block 21 inside is connected with clamping plate 15, and fixture block 14 can rotate the second link block 21 when fixture block 1 rotates in 20 inner cavity of the first groove It being rotated simultaneously with clamping plate 15, the inside of clamping plate 15 is connected with the first rubber pad 16, and rubber pad 16 plays the role of increasing frictional force, The top of first link block 2 is connected with casing 3, and when needing to adjust height, the second connecting column is plugged in the inner cavity of casing 3 17, the second connecting column 17 and 3 clearance fit of casing, the second connecting column 17 can slide up and down in the inner cavity of casing 3, casing 3 Right side screw thread be connected with bolt 18, the left side of bolt 18 is connected with jacking block 19, and jacking block can be by casing 3 and the second connecting column 17 Fixed, the right side of bolt 18 is connected with nut 23, and rotating screw cap 23 can be such that bolt 18 is rotated.
When lithium battery group weldering bracket begins to use, the first link block 2 is fixed by the second connecting column 17, the second connecting column 17 It is fixedly linked with the inner ring of first bearing 5, the first connecting column 4 can be in the outer ring rotating of first bearing 5, by the insertion of inserted link 6 the , can be fixed by the first connecting column 4 and the second connecting column 17 when in one connecting column 4 and the second connecting column 17, prevent the second connection Bar 4 is continued to rotate with the second connecting column 17, and stud 8 can be such that nut 9 moves left and right in the outer wall of stud 8 when rotating, when nut 9 First connecting rod 11 moves left and right in the inner cavity of sliding slot 10 simultaneously when moving left and right, and first connecting rod 11 is moved in sliding slot 10 or so It when dynamic, be fixed in 11 fixed plate 12 of first connecting rod while moving left and right, make the second connecting column when first connecting rod 11 is mobile 13 move left and right, and it is same that fixture block 14 can rotate the second link block 21 and clamping plate 15 when fixture block 1 rotates in 20 inner cavity of the first groove When rotate, complete to weld the clamping of flat lithium battery rotation.
